Major Collision Blocks Traffic on Highway 101

Los Angeles, May 12, 2025 -

A significant traffic collision occurred today on US Highway 101 West at De Soto Avenue in Los Angeles, CA, involving five vehicles, including a sideways-facing SUV, a black Chevrolet Suburban, a silver Jeep, a Kia, and an unknown vehicle. The incident took place during the afternoon, leading to substantial traffic disruptions as multiple lanes were blocked.

Emergency response units arrived promptly to manage the scene and coordinate towing services for the vehicles involved. The black Chevrolet Suburban and the silver Jeep were reported to have sustained major damage, requiring tow trucks to clear the area effectively. As a result of the lane blockages, traffic congestion quickly built up, impacting the flow of vehicles and causing delays for motorists.

Drivers in the area are advised to seek alternate routes to avoid backups caused by this traffic incident. The California Highway Patrol is actively managing the situation to restore normal traffic conditions as swiftly as possible. Motorists are encouraged to remain cautious and patient while navigating through the affected area.
